What family does Peale’s Free-tailed Bat belong to?
Peale’s Free-tailed Bat (Nyctinomops aurispinosus) belongs to the genus Nyctinomops, which is part of the taxonomic family Molossidae.

What are the closest relatives of Peale’s Free-tailed Bat?
The closest relatives of Peale’s Free-tailed Bat in the genus Nyctinomops include Broad-eared Free-tailed Bat, Big Free-tailed Bat, Pocketed Free-tailed Bat.
